From 7cbccbbb5bec57912c2775e296bc33639db15cf6 Mon Sep 17 00:00:00 2001 From: Lightos1 <124387232+Lightos1@users.noreply.github.com> Date: Sun, 15 Mar 2026 14:07:12 +0100 Subject: [PATCH] Simplify dram module switch statement --- .../sys-clk/overlay/src/ui/gui/about_gui.cpp | 20 ++++++------------- 1 file changed, 6 insertions(+), 14 deletions(-) diff --git a/Source/sys-clk/overlay/src/ui/gui/about_gui.cpp b/Source/sys-clk/overlay/src/ui/gui/about_gui.cpp index e68ebd42..76c8c888 100644 --- a/Source/sys-clk/overlay/src/ui/gui/about_gui.cpp +++ b/Source/sys-clk/overlay/src/ui/gui/about_gui.cpp @@ -231,8 +231,7 @@ std::string AboutGui::formatRamModule() { case 2: return "WT:C"; case 3: - case 5: - case 6: return "NEE"; + case 5 ... 6: return "NEE"; case 8: case 12: return "AM-MGCJ 4GB"; @@ -248,25 +247,18 @@ std::string AboutGui::formatRamModule() { case 17: case 19: case 24: return "AA-MGCL 4GB"; + case 18: case 23: case 28: return "AA-MGCL 8GB"; - case 20: - case 21: - case 22: return "AB-MGCL 4GB"; + case 20 ... 22: return "AB-MGCL 4GB"; - case 25: - case 26: - case 27: return "WT:F"; + case 25 ... 27: return "WT:F"; - case 29: - case 30: - case 31: return "x267"; + case 29 ... 31: return "x267"; - case 32: - case 33: - case 34: return "WT:B"; + case 32 ... 34: return "WT:B"; default: return "Unknown"; }